HalExtIntcLpioDMA.dll Download

  • Download HalExtIntcLpioDMA.dll
  • Size: 10.91 KB

Download Button

Understanding HalExtIntcLpioDMA.dll: A Deep Dive into Windows System Components

The intricate architecture of the Windows operating system relies on a multitude of dynamic-link libraries (DLLs) to manage system functions, hardware interactions, and software execution. One such component that plays a critical, albeit often unseen, role in the internal workings of modern computers is HalExtIntcLpioDMA.dll. This file is directly associated with the Hardware Abstraction Layer (HAL) and is crucial for managing specific input/output operations, particularly those involving the Intel Low Power Input/Output (LPIO) and Direct Memory Access (DMA) capabilities. Understanding this DLL is key to troubleshooting certain performance issues and system errors, especially on devices utilizing modern Intel chipsets.

Modern computing environments demand efficient power management and rapid data transfer, and this is where HalExtIntcLpioDMA.dll steps in. It serves as an essential bridge between the operating system’s kernel and the underlying hardware, translating generic OS requests into specific, hardware-compatible instructions. Specifically, it facilitates the use of DMA, a technique that allows hardware subsystems to access system memory independently of the central processing unit (CPU). This reduces the CPU load and significantly enhances the speed of data transfer for low-power devices and integrated peripherals, which is vital for modern laptops and tablets running Windows.

The Critical Role of HalExtIntcLpioDMA in System Stability

A stable Windows environment depends heavily on the proper functioning of system files like HalExtIntcLpioDMA.dll. Errors related to this file, often manifested as ‘File not found’ or ‘Application failed to start because HalExtIntcLpioDMA.dll was not found,’ can lead to various issues. These problems frequently surface after major Windows updates, hardware driver installations, or due to corruption from malicious software. Because this DLL is deeply embedded within the HAL framework, its failure can affect peripheral performance, leading to audio glitches, unresponsive touchpads, or even complete system crashes, particularly the dreaded Blue Screen of Death (BSOD) with error codes referencing I/O or driver conflicts.

The Hardware Abstraction Layer (HAL) is a layer of software that shields the operating system kernel from the specific details of the hardware platform. HalExtIntcLpioDMA.dll extends this core functionality by providing tailored support for Intel’s modern I/O controllers that employ LPIO interfaces for enhanced power efficiency. When the operating system needs to communicate with a peripheral like an embedded controller, the HAL, via this specific DLL, ensures that the communication is handled efficiently, maintaining system responsiveness and minimizing power consumption, a paramount concern for mobile devices.

Maintaining the integrity of this file is therefore a fundamental aspect of system maintenance. Regular execution of system file checks and keeping drivers fully updated are proactive steps that users can take to prevent issues. The unique challenge with this DLL is its tight integration with specific hardware components; a mismatch between the installed hardware drivers and the version of this DLL can instantly cause system instability and unexpected shutdowns, demanding precise troubleshooting skills.

How DMA and LPIO Intersect in Modern Chipsets

To fully grasp the DLL’s function, it’s necessary to understand its two core technical underpinnings: DMA and LPIO. Direct Memory Access (DMA) is a powerful technique that allows certain hardware interfaces to read from or write to Random Access Memory (RAM) without the involvement of the CPU. This is essential for high-speed peripherals. The ‘LPIO’ or Low Power Input/Output component refers to the energy-efficient I/O controllers found in modern Intel mobile and desktop platforms. HalExtIntcLpioDMA.dll is the software translator that manages DMA requests for devices connected via these LPIO interfaces.

The synergy between LPIO and DMA, orchestrated by this DLL, is key to the overall performance of systems running Windows 10 and 11. For instance, when streaming audio or handling high-resolution touch input, the data must move quickly and with minimal power usage. The DLL ensures the DMA controller is correctly programmed for the LPIO device, allowing data to bypass the CPU for maximum efficiency. If this DLL is corrupted or missing, the system may revert to less efficient, CPU-intensive methods for I/O, leading to slowdowns and increased heat generation.

Furthermore, the DLL is often updated alongside major driver packages for Intel chipsets. These updates are not just bug fixes; they often introduce performance enhancements or support for new hardware revisions. Ignoring these updates can leave the system operating with suboptimal efficiency or facing compatibility problems with newer peripherals. It is crucial to obtain these updates exclusively through official channels such as Windows Update or the manufacturer’s support website to ensure file integrity and security.

Troubleshooting Common HalExtIntcLpioDMA.dll Errors

Addressing errors related to HalExtIntcLpioDMA.dll requires a structured approach. The primary cause is often a corrupted or missing file. The System File Checker (SFC) utility is the first line of defense. Running sfc /scannow from an elevated Command Prompt can automatically detect and replace corrupted system files, including this DLL, with a cached, working version. This process is non-destructive and highly effective for simple file corruption issues.

If SFC fails to resolve the issue, the next step involves using the Deployment Image Servicing and Management (DISM) tool. This utility is more powerful and can repair the underlying Windows system image from which SFC draws its clean copies. Commands like DISM /Online /Cleanup-Image /RestoreHealth are invaluable for fixing deep-seated corruption that affects the entire Windows installation, ensuring that the system’s foundational components are sound before attempting further troubleshooting.

Beyond file corruption, a common cause is an outdated or incorrectly installed hardware driver, specifically the chipset drivers. Since HalExtIntcLpioDMA.dll is tied to Intel I/O functionality, users should visit the device manufacturer’s (OEM) or Intel’s official support portal to check for the latest chipset, I/O, and system device drivers. A complete and clean reinstallation of the correct drivers often rectifies the communication breakdown that manifests as a DLL error.

Preventative Maintenance and System Updates

Proactive maintenance is the best strategy against DLL errors. Ensuring that Windows Update is actively managed is paramount. Microsoft regularly releases cumulative updates that include patches for the HAL and related system components, which often address subtle bugs within files like HalExtIntcLpioDMA.dll. Delaying these updates can expose the system to known stability issues and vulnerabilities.

Another crucial step is to perform regular disk cleanup and optimization. While seemingly unrelated, a system drive cluttered with temporary files and fragmented data can occasionally interfere with the quick and efficient loading of critical system files. Utilizing the built-in Windows tools to maintain a clean and optimized drive ensures that the operating system can access the necessary DLLs, including this one, without delay or corruption.

Finally, maintaining a current, reliable antivirus and anti-malware solution is non-negotiable. Malicious software is a frequent culprit behind file corruption and system destabilization. Many modern viruses target system files to hide their presence or to disrupt normal operation. A robust security suite can prevent these compromises, ensuring the integrity of HalExtIntcLpioDMA.dll and thousands of other critical system components are preserved against external threats in real-time.

Security Implications and Official Sources

A critical point of caution for users experiencing DLL errors is the potential security risk associated with incorrect resolution methods. Searching for system files online and downloading them from unofficial third-party websites is strongly discouraged. These sources often host outdated, incompatible, or, most dangerously, malware-infected versions of legitimate files. A compromised HalExtIntcLpioDMA.dll could grant malicious code deep access to the system’s core functions, leading to catastrophic security breaches. The only safe and reliable way to replace or repair this file is through official means.

The only legitimate sources for a correct and secure version of HalExtIntcLpioDMA.dll are Microsoft’s Windows Update service and the official driver packages provided by the original equipment manufacturer (OEM) or Intel itself. Utilizing the SFC and DISM tools relies on the integrity of the operating system’s local component store, which is the safest mechanism for repairing internal file damage. Never attempt to manually copy a DLL from another computer or an untrusted source, as version mismatch is highly likely to cause immediate and irreparable system damage, demanding a full operating system reinstallation.

In summary, HalExtIntcLpioDMA.dll is a foundational component of the Windows HAL, integral to managing high-efficiency DMA operations for Intel’s LPIO devices. Its smooth operation is directly linked to system stability, peripheral performance, and power efficiency. By prioritizing official updates, utilizing built-in repair tools like SFC and DISM, and maintaining robust security practices, users can ensure the integrity of this critical DLL and enjoy a consistently reliable and optimized Windows experience well into the future.